It happens to everyone.  Sometimes the best you can hope for is to learn something that day.  Most of my days out this year have been far from stellar, even on stretches of water that I routinely catch 25+ in a day.  Sometimes we get in the habit of fishing the past, ignore a lot of things, and miss patterns that are right in front of us.  Other times, we fish tricky conditions and patterns that may have crushed days earlier end up being useless.  Fishing is basically trying to solve a constantly evolving puzzle.  That's what makes it exciting.
